Doliver Advisors LP Takes $488,000 Position in PayPal Holdings, Inc. $PYPL

Doliver Advisors LP purchased a new position in PayPal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:PYPLFree Report) in the 2nd qu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The institutional investor purchased 11,301 shares of the credit services provider’s stock, valued at approximately $488,000.

  • Positive Sentiment: PayPal expanded its credit-card financing reach. A partnership with Synchrony now makes six-month promotional financing available to eligible PayPal Credit Card holders for purchases of at least $149 across the Mastercard network, both online and in stores. Broader usage could support transaction volume and customer engagement, although it also carries credit and execution risks. PayPal Stock Performance

Shares of PYPL stock opened at $59.00 on Wednesday. PayPal Holdings, Inc. has a 12-month low of $38.46 and a 12-month high of $79.21. The business’s fifty day simple moving average is $49.03 and its 200-day simple moving average is $47.13. The company has a current ratio of 1.29, a quick ratio of 1.29 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.55. The company has a market cap of $50.47 billion, a PE ratio of 11.15, a PEG ratio of 1.44 and a beta of 1.29.

PayPal (NASDAQ:PYPLG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 28th. The credit services provider reported $1.38 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.28 by $0.10. PayPal had a return on equity of 24.39% and a net margin of 14.36%.The firm had revenue of $8.68 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$8.47 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$1.40 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 4.8%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ts expect that PayPal Holdings, Inc. will post 5.37 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

PayPal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, September 25th. Shareholders of record on Friday, September 4th will be paid a $0.14 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, September 4th. This represents a $0.56 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.9%. PayPal’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 10.59%.

About PayPal

PayPal Holdings, Inc operates a global digital payments platform that enables consumers and merchants to send and receive payments online, on mobile devices and at the point of sale. The company provides a broad set of payment solutions, including a digital wallet, merchant payment processing, checkout services, invoicing and fraud-management tools. PayPal’s platform is designed to support e-commerce, in-person retail and person-to-person transfers, targeting both individual consumers and businesses of varying sizes.

Key products and services in PayPal’s portfolio include the PayPal wallet and checkout ecosystem, the Venmo peer-to-peer mobile app, Braintree’s developer-focused payment gateway, Xoom for international money transfers, and PayPal Credit and buy-now-pay-later options.
